Obituary: Nevada Naomi Airy

A memorial service for Nevada Naomi Airy, 60, of Grangeville, Idaho, will be at 10 a.m. July 13 at the city park there.

Mrs. Airy died June 15, 2003, at St. Joseph Regional Medical Center in Lewiston, Idaho, of respiratory failure. She was born Dec. 16, 1942, in Kirkland, Wash., to Elsie Kain Schweitzer and Henry S. Ziegler.

She lived in Kirkland from 1942 to 1943, Reno in 1944 and several locations in Oregon and Washington before moving to Port Townsend, Wash., in 1951. In 1955, she moved to Alameda, Calif.

She attended schools in Port Townsend, and LincolnJunior High School and Encinal High School, both in Alameda, Calif.

She married George T. Airy on Jan. 12, 1964, in Reno. They lived in Hilton, N.Y., from 1954 to 1967, then moved to Carson City in 1991. She retired from Kmart as an assistant manager, and they moved to Grangeville.

She was preceded in death by her parents, and grandparents Hazel Auranger and Thomas Kain.

Among her survivors are her husband of Grangeville; daughters and sons-in-law Tina M. and Norman Lowe of Hampton Roads, Va., and Darri L. and Craig Cadwallader of Cottonwood, Idaho; brother and sister-in-law, Henry T. and Pam Ziegler of Grangeville; sister and brother-in-law, Emily Ann and Nick Perros of Grangeville; four grandchildren and three great-grandchildren.

Malcom's Funeral Home of Lewiston, Idaho, is in charge of arrangements.
